Tell us a little bit about yourself.

I teach secondary school for a living – mostly theatre arts, fine art and English. I have four grown children and one granddaughter. My husband was a pastor for many years and we still unofficially minister in our church when called upon to do so. We have moved more times than I have fingers and toes, so I have a lot of different settings and such in my head waiting to be made into novels!

Tell us about your current release.

Neighbors Vol 1Right now I am working on a serialized novel called NEIGHBORS published by ‘Helping Hands Press’. Each installment comes out approximately every three weeks. It centers around the characters living in an apartment building in Calgary, Alberta, starting with a relocated cowboy who has had to move to the city to find work. I am also collaborating on another series called COLONY ZERO, a Sci-fi novel that takes place 800 years in the future. I am excited about both projects and the whole process of collaborating is especially invigorating.

Bio:

Tracy Krauss is a multi-published author, artist, and playwright. She has a Bachelor’s degree from the University of Saskatchewan and teaches secondary school Art, Drama and English – all things she is passionate about. She and her husband have lived in five provinces and territories including many remote and unique places in Canada’s far north. They have four grown children and now reside in beautiful Tumbler Ridge, BC where she continues to pursue all of her creative interests. She has several romantic suspense novels and stage plays in print. For more information visit her website at http://www.tracykrauss.com
